On April 3, 2025, Stryker's trading volume reached $1.218 billion, marking an 80.44% increase from the previous day and ranking 105th in the day's stock market activity. However, Stryker's stock price decreased by 2.47%.

Stryker recently completed the sale of its U.S. spinal implants business to Viscogliosi Brothers. This transaction, which was initially agreed upon on January 28, 2025, marks a significant strategic move for StrykerSYK--. The sale is part of Stryker's ongoing efforts to streamline its portfolio and focus on core competencies. The divestment of the spinal implants business allows Stryker to concentrate on its strengths in MedSurg, Neurotechnology, and Orthopaedics, areas where the company has a strong market presence and innovative product offerings.
